It feels like deja vu all over again. For the second time in three years, a former four-star Kentucky defensive back is leaving the program to transfer to Pitt.

Jaremiah Anglin announced on Sunday afternoon that he is making the move to the ACC to play for Pat Narduzzi’s program in Pittsburgh. Even though his time in Lexington was brief, it was noteworthy.

Also known by the moniker “Grady Judd,” Anglin was the No. 222 ranked player in the 2023 recruiting class. Despite the hype, he had to spend his entire freshman season on the sideline with a knee injury. He was cleared to play just a few days before the Kentucky spring game, where he made one of the biggest plays of the day. Anglin picked off a pass and took it to the house to end the scrimmage.

Anglin is following a similar path to MJ Devonshire, with a few notable differences. Devonshire was a four-star cornerback who spent two seasons in Lexington, notching two pass deflections in four games. Transferring to Pitt made a bit more sense. A native of Aliquippa, PA, his move was a return home, one that worked out well for the cornerback.

Devonshire played significant snaps right away, helping Pitt win the 2021 ACC Championship. He opened the following season by recording a go-ahead pick six in the final minutes of a win over West Virginia in The Backyard Brawl. He logged eight interceptions over three seasons and on Saturday Devonshire was selected in the seventh round of the NFL Draft by the Las Vegas Raiders.

Kentucky Football Departures in the Spring Transfer Portal Window

Eight Kentucky football players entered the transfer portal after the conclusion of spring practice. WR Cole Lanter recently announced his commitment to Gardner-Webb, leaving five players still in search of a new college football home.

  • DB Jordan Robinson (Entered transfer portal on April 24)
  • WR Shamar Porter (Entered transfer portal on April 22)
  • P/K Jackson Smith (Entered transfer portal on April 22)
  • WR Ardell Banks (Entered transfer portal on April 22)
  • WR Raymond Cottrell (Entered transfer portal on April 16)
  • DB Jaremiah Anglin (Entered transfer portal on April 23): Committed to Pitt on April 28
  • WR Cole Lanter (Entered transfer portal on April 16): Committed to Gardner-Webb on April 23
  • RB La’Vell Wright (Entered transfer portal on April 10): Committed to Austin Peay on April 24
